Output 66e3ce5045ab1e08d40f2bf157ffae8962cbdb020f748ca1ba59d89dd507e021:0

value
825258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db4d5c5032fb2bdb7d4b702f224bcaad0cd991f8 OP_EQUAL
address
3MgaafRRMZho4JjwzNC8cUeZjFf13J29M6
transaction
66e3ce5045ab1e08d40f2bf157ffae8962cbdb020f748ca1ba59d89dd507e021
spent
true